Eight EVs tested on range and energy efficiency
Eight plug-in electric vehicles have been tested on their real-world range and energy efficiency in the cold.
German auto industry news source Auto Bild did the tests in Ahlhorn, Oldenburg and Delmenhorst forest in Lower Saxony in temperatures around 5° Celsius (with the climate control set to 21°C, so heating affected results).
Some overseas media note test models were interesting, with the 24kWh Nissan e-NV200 Evalia used rather than the Nissan Leaf, for instance.
All of the EVs were tested along the same 143km route, which included a 43km highway stretch at up to 130km/h. Apparently, a couple of the models tested didn’t manage to complete the route, CleanTechnica reports.
It says the Hyundai Ioniq and the Renault Zoe clearly show why they are among some of the best options for those wanting to buy an EV.

Results.
Volkswagen e-up (18.7kWh) 79km range, 23.7kWh/100km energy efficiency; Smart ForTwo Electric Drive (17.6kWh) 84km, 21kWh/100km; Nissan e-NV200 Evalia (24kWh)101km, 23.8kWh/100km; Kia Soul EV (30kWh) 167km, 18kWh/100km; Hyundai Ioniq Electric (28kWh usable) 192km, 14.6kWh/100km; Volkswagen e-Golf (35.8kWh) 208km, 17.2kWh/100km; Renault Zoe (41kWh) 244km, 16.8kWh/100km; Opel Ampera-e (60kWh), 273km, 22kWh/100km.
PushEVs suggests the results could look a lot different if the Tesla Model 3 and the refreshed Nissan Leaf had been tested as well.
